Record-breaking heat waves swept across much of Asia, Europe and North America. Scientists confirm that 2023 will be the hottest year in recorded history.

One of the biggest stories and most widely supported initiatives coming out of the 2023 UN Climate Change Conference (CO28) in Dubai, UAE is the pledge to triple the world’s installed renewable energy capacity by 2030 to limit global temperature rise to 1.5°C.
